POSITION OVERVIEW
Black Briar Management is seeking an experienced, highly organized, and results-driven Project Manager to oversee corporate capital improvement projects, property renovations, building renewals, and strategic operational initiatives across our portfolio.
This role serves as the primary point of coordination between ownership, executive leadership, property management teams, developers, engineers, contractors, vendors, and consultants to ensure projects are delivered on time, within budget, and to BBM's luxury hospitality standards.
The ideal candidate has 5–7 years of project management experience, preferably within luxury residential, hospitality, commercial real estate, hotel or condohotel, or property management environments. This individual thrives in fast-paced organizations, manages multiple concurrent projects with ease, communicates effectively with diverse stakeholders, and proactively solves problems before they impact operations. This position reports directly to the Director of Project Management and requires occasional travel throughout South Florida properties and project sites.
CORE RESPONSIBILITIES
Project Management & Strategic Initiative Execution: Lead the planning, coordination, and execution of corporate and property-level projects, including new and existing property launches, operational improvements, technology initiatives, and service enhancement programs. Ensure projects are properly scoped, assigned, tracked, and completed within established timelines while supporting BBM’s commitment to operational excellence and elevated resident experiences.
Project Tracking & Workflow Management: Utilize Monday.com as the primary project management platform to create, organize, track, and maintain project timelines, milestones, responsibilities, priorities, and deliverables. Ensure visibility across teams by maintaining accurate project status updates, identifying potential delays, and proactively escalating risks or challenges that may impact completion.
New and Existing Property Launch Coordination: Support the launch of company management and services in newly built properties and existing properties across BBM’s portfolio. Coordinate with property teams, leadership, and external partners to ensure projects align with operational needs, resident expectations, and BBM standards.
Innovation & Process Improvement: Identify opportunities to improve operational efficiency, enhance service delivery, and implement innovative solutions across BBM communities and corporate operations. Evaluate existing processes, recommend improvements, and support the implementation of new systems, workflows, and technologies that create better experiences for residents, employees, and stakeholders.
Technology & IT Project Coordination: Identify and lead technology-related projects, system improvements, troubleshooting efforts, and operational solutions in partnership with leadership, property teams and our IT provider. Assist in identifying technology needs, tracking resolutions, following up on open items, and ensuring technology initiatives are completed effectively to support business operations.
Cross-Functional Collaboration: Serve as the connection point between Corporate Leadership, Operations, Finance, People & Culture, vendors, and technology partners. Facilitate communication, align priorities, coordinate resources, and ensure teams remain accountable for project commitments.
Timeline & Accountability Management: Establish clear deadlines, milestones, and ownership for projects while monitoring progress and ensuring timely completion. Proactively identify roadblocks, coordinate solutions, and drive projects forward by keeping stakeholders aligned and focused on results.
Vendor & Partner Coordination: Coordinate with external vendors, service providers, consultants, and partners to support project execution, renewals, upgrades, and operational improvements. Maintain strong relationships, monitor performance, and ensure deliverables meet BBM’s quality expectations.
Problem Solving & Resolution Management: Take ownership of project challenges by identifying root causes, coordinating solutions, and following through until resolution. Bring a proactive mindset focused on preventing issues, improving workflows, and creating sustainable solutions.
Reporting & Leadership Updates: Prepare project updates, dashboards, summaries, and presentations for leadership, highlighting project progress, completed initiatives, upcoming milestones, risks, and recommendations. Maintain transparency and ensure leadership has visibility into key priorities.
Continuous Improvement & Operational Excellence: Support BBM’s continued growth by identifying opportunities to streamline operations, improve communication, enhance service delivery, and develop scalable processes that support a growing property management portfolio.
